The recommended soldering temperature for the 1N4007SG is between 240°C to 260°C for a maximum of 5 seconds.
No, the 1N4007SG is a standard rectifier diode and is not suitable for high-frequency applications. It's recommended to use a high-frequency diode such as the 1N4148 or 1N4933 for those applications.
The maximum surge current rating for the 1N4007SG is 30A for a single half-cycle surge.
Yes, the 1N4007SG can be used in a switching power supply, but it's not the best choice due to its relatively high forward voltage drop and reverse recovery time. A faster diode such as the 1N4933 or 1N4934 would be a better choice.
Yes, the 1N4007SG diode is RoHS (Restriction of Hazardous Substances) compliant, meaning it does not contain hazardous substances such as lead, mercury, or cadmium.
